Technical differences between repair options

Different repair options are suitable for different applications, however, these overlap to such an extent that a clear methodology for making a decision on technical or cost grounds is difficult as each structure and type of structure is different. What is acceptable on a bridge deck is not applicable and acceptable on a substructure or a building. Costs of access vary widely as do the implication of noise, vibration and dust. [Pg.209]

A simplified table of technical issues that may exclude some repair options is also given later. This lists some issues such as the design of the structure and other problems that may eliminate certain options or may severely increase the cost of using them. [Pg.209]
